Microsoft to release a budget version of the Surface laptop

Microsoft has reportedly been working on a new surface laptop. The new surface laptop is rumored to be a budget version release.

According to Winfuture, the new surface laptop will run on Core i5 1035G1. then quad-core processor belongs to Intel’s old Ice Lake-U generation family. The processor also comes with 8 threads, 6MB of L3 cache, and four sunny clove cores. This chipset is also based on the 10nm process.

The surface laptop has made an appearance on the Geekbench benchmarking website. This has revealed a lot of details about the upcoming laptop.

It is revealed that the new surface laptop will be available in both 8GB of RAM and 16GB of RAM. The laptop is said to come in 8GB with 128/256 GB storage variants as well as 16GB with a 256GB SSD model.

Microsoft is also said to release a base model of 4GB, as it has always done with may of its products. However, the models with 8GB and 16GB models will reportedly by costlier than the 4GB variant.

The surface GO comes with a 10-inch display. It also comes featured with 8GB of RAM, up to 128GB storage, 5-megapixel front-facing camera, 8-megapixel rear camera, and comes with Intel Pentium Gold Processor 4415Y.

This will be the first time Microsoft will release any model with Intel’s 10th gen Core i5 1035G1 processor. But it is quite surprising to see Intel opting for Ice Lake instead of the new and promising Tiger Lake CPUs with Intel Xe graphics, maybe to cut down the prices.

The appearance of the new Surface laptop on the Geekbench benchmarking website has given away a lot of information. However, any other information such as the Wifi module, battery capacity and type, and other valuable information is not determined. Speculations have come up that if the new Surface model sporting a 10th gen processor has to be budget-oriented than Microsoft has to make some sacrifices in other departments.

Microsoft Surface models have always been performance-oriented laptops and are best suited for professional office workers. A budget-oriented laptop of this series is sure to improve the sales market of the market.

Whether the new surface model will appeal to the buyers, only can be determined after the complete spec reveals the product.
